What a delight to find a real bargain.
I had been considering buying a projector in the £300 - £350 bracket, but eventually couldn't justify the price for the very occasional use to which I would put it. Rather than ditch the whole idea I took a chance on this projector, priced at the very low end of the market, thinking that I wouldn't have too much to lose if it didn't deliver the goods.A primary reason for choosing this model was its high native resolution - just a hair short of XGA and well above the competition.The projector is light in weight, has inputs for HDMI (2), USB, SD card and VGA cable. It comes with a remote control and an HDMI cable. The LED light source is perfectly bright enough to use at close range or in subdued lighting, though it is at its best in a dark room. While not up to the brightness of the mercury lamps used in up-market projectors, the LED lamp has the advantage of cool running and a very long maintenance-free lifetime. Colour rendition and sharpness are very good. The in-built speaker is not at all tinny and can deliver quite high volume.In common with many other projectors of this type there are three areas where it is a bit compromised; it is critical on focus - not a problem if the projector is placed perfectly horizontally, but if it is pointing a little up or down with respect to the screen, then adjusting the picture with the keystone control throws the top and bottom of the image a little out of focus. Bear in mind that the image is projected as far below the lens as above it, so you can't really put it on a coffee table and have it angled upwards to the screen - it needs to be placed roughly on a level with the centre of the screen. Because it has very short throw (wide angle) optics it delivers a big picture and it can be difficult to get the projector far enough away from the screen not to be obtrusive. However, there is an inbuilt digital zoom which can reduce the image size by 25% to help fit the image to the screen if the projector needs to be placed further back. Also, the cooling fan is noisy, which is irritating since the projector needs to be so close to the audience.That said, everything else is rosy. There has been much attention to detail in the design of the projector (even down to the remote control having luminous buttons and there being front and back IR detectors on the projector). It is hard to see how so many ticked boxes could have been delivered in such a low-priced projector.If you're in the market at this price-point and understand its few querks, you simply can't go wrong. An honest bargain, and highly recommended.

Awful projector
For the money I paid I was not expecting cinema-like quality, but I was expecting an image that was at least watchable. This item is described as having a Native resolution of 720P, it has NOT. one previous review compares it to a childs novelty toy, that is an insult to childrens toys. The image displayed is abysmal even after adjusting the settings in the menu (which are few and far between), The limited options mean the image is too bright at the centre of the screen and dark at the edges or totally unwatchable completely. Using the focus option means either any text is clear in one area and unreadable in another or just unreadable completely. I have it projected on to a quality Optoma 92" screen and the image is terrible. I first tried watching a movie from a usb stick that was in 1080x720p, the projector informed me it was playing the image back as 720x304 . Next I linked it to my V6 box which has a Native resolution of 1920x1080p, Yes the projector played back the image as 1080p but it was terrible, even after adjusting the settings,(for a good 15 mins) the colours were washed out, the image was not good, it was not even standard definition quality never mind HD. I suppose at this price point I should not be surprised but I was expecting more after reading some good reviews (fake ?). Lesson learned.
